1. Charming Apartment on Paris’ Most Colorful Street 

You may have seen Rue Crémieux in many Instagram pictures as one of the city’s most photogenic streets. The 35 vibrantly-colored houses remind us a bit of London’s Notting Hill and serve as one of Paris’ worst kept secrets, definitely worth an afternoon stroll. Take up a stay at one of these colorful homes and open your door straight into a storybook.

3. Flintstone’s Cave Home in the Loire

The Loire Valley is famous for its castles and vineyards, and also for its small compilation of cave homes carved into a rock massif. Today these caves still serve as homes and have also been turned into galleries, restaurants, hotels, and more. It is a unique stay like no other in France.

4. Stay at Picasso’s Favorite Poet’s Home 

Listing image 1

This restored 12th century apartment was inhabited by the legendary French poet, writer, and screenwriter Jacques Prévert in the 1940’s. It is a sure gem of Provence, and has been classified by Condé Nast Traveler as one of the best Airbnb’s in the South of France.

7. On the Annecy Canals

The Alps region of France is breathtaking all year around, with Annecy being its prized city of fairytale wonder. Nicknamed the Venice of France, it is a sure charmer with its medieval architecture and river canals that channel out into the Annecy Lake, where you can go swimming, sailing, water-skiing, or even paragliding.
